JOB DESCRIPTION: We have an immediate opening for a Test Engineer to support a software systems engineering effort focused on software and associated product development. Candidates will be expected to test more than one application at the same time in order to meet overlapping development schedules. Candidates should be comfortable sharing and managing test responsibilities with software developers as needed to meet deadlines.
Shall be proficient in the development and implementation of test strategies, plans, traceability matrices, procedures, and reports.
Shall have experience with automated test methods and automated test tools.
Shall have a minimum of three (3) years of requirements analysis experience and in particular must be fully trained or have experience in the testing of systems at the component, integration, system, and end-to-end levels.
Shall have experience in writing test cases and writing discrepancy reports.
Shall have experience in basic UNIX, DOS, and Windows commands and basic understanding of capturing snapshots.
TYPICAL EDUCATION AND EXPERIENCE: Candidates must have at least 5 years experience as a TE and a Bachelor’s degree in Math, Science, Engineering, Statistics, Engineering Management, or related discipline.
Bachelor’s degree from an accredited college or university. Four (4) years of additional TE experience may be substituted for a Bachelor’s degree.
Master’s degree can be substituted for two (2) years experience
TS/SCI w/ polygraph
**We cannot accept CCA candidates for these positions, and polygraphs must have been completed within the last seven years.
Desired technical skills include experience with:
- Writing test cases
- Testing to include data verification (e.g., with PGAdmin)
- Testing in an Agile development environment